VB问题?

lengyang 2003-12-12 06:59:14
请问如何编程把一个EXE程序包含在自己的VB程序中,使自己的程序执行后自动生成该EXE程序?

系统环境为:windows2000Pro +vb6中文企业版
...全文
14 10 打赏 收藏 举报
写回复
10 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
lengyang 2003-12-15
ok解决 谢谢大家
  • 打赏
  • 举报
回复
firechun 2003-12-15
把EXE文件放到资源文件中,运行用loadresdata读到字节数组中,然后写到文件中
代码如下:
dim bytData() as byte
bytdata=loadresdata(101,"CUSTOM")
open app.path &"\test.exe" for binary as #1
put #1,,bytdata
close #1
  • 打赏
  • 举报
回复
lengyang 2003-12-15
请问如何把资源文件解开为.EXE文件?
  • 打赏
  • 举报
回复
rexueqingnian 2003-12-13
用一个make 文件名 exe 就行拉
  • 打赏
  • 举报
回复
a11s 2003-12-13
把它定义为一个资源文件,运行的时候解开这个资源文件为 临时文件.exe就可以了
  • 打赏
  • 举报
回复
lengyang 2003-12-12
我的意思是把两个程序合在一起,在运行自己写的VB程序时自动把包含在里面的EXE生成出来
  • 打赏
  • 举报
回复
zt31 2003-12-12
不明白什么意思,最好讲清楚点
  • 打赏
  • 举报
回复
chutianqi 2003-12-12
用OLE1控件可以把EXE文件包含在程序中(就是和本身的程序是一个文件),至于怎么样生成该EXE文件就不清楚了,关注一下吧
  • 打赏
  • 举报
回复
SoHo_Andy 2003-12-12
在你的form_load 或者 模块的sub main 中加入
shell "完整路径\*.exe"
  • 打赏
  • 举报
回复
lengyang 2003-12-12
我自己先顶,解决就结帖。
  • 打赏
  • 举报
回复
相关推荐
发帖
VB基础类

7617

社区成员

VB 基础类
社区管理员
  • VB基础类社区
加入社区
帖子事件
创建了帖子
2003-12-12 06:59
社区公告
暂无公告